Brake lights not coming on

2000 PLYMOUTH VOYAGER
163,000 MILES • 3.0L • 6 CYL • 2WD • AUTOMATIC

Replaced the bulbs, brake lights still won't come on. Taillights are fine so it is not a bulb issue. Checked brake light fuse it is fine so is my brake light switch. 3rd brake light is the only brake that lights up. Any suggestions on what to try next?

I attached a wiring diagram for you to view.

Please verify the white/tan wire off the brake light switch has power with the pedal depressed.

If it does and the 3rd light works, there may be an issue at the splice I circled where the wires to the rear lights come from.
